Clinger Sets American 25 km Record at USATF Championships in Michigan

Berry fourth in women's race

Results

Two athletes from USATF Utah delivered outstanding performances at the 2025 USATF 25 km Championships, held May 10 at the Amway River Bank Run in Grand Rapids, Michigan.

Casey Clinger (Provo) stole the spotlight by not only winning the men’s championship but also breaking the American record, finishing in 1:12:17. His time shattered the previous record of 1:14:21, set by Fernando Cabada in 2006 at the same event. Clinger’s victory also marked one of the fastest long-distance performances ever by a Utah runner on the national stage.

On the women’s side, Savannah Berry (Orem) turned in a strong performance of her own, placing fourth overall in 1:25:42 against a deep national field.
